Poland reports surge in Belarus-origin drone flights, tightens border checks

Poland reports surge in Belarus-origin drone flights, tightens border checks

Poland’s military recorded multiple drone incursions from Belarus on 22 January, prompting extra vehicle and identity checks at the eastern frontier. The incident underscores continuing hybrid threats and may cause short-term delays for freight and business travellers using the Belarus crossings.

Sweden sets March state visit to Poland with focus on talent mobility and defence ties

Sweden sets March state visit to Poland with focus on talent mobility and defence ties

A 22 January announcement confirms Sweden’s King and Queen will visit Poland in March, accompanied by ministers and business leaders to sign a memorandum streamlining work-permits and launching a pilot ‘Pol-Swe Tech Passport’. Faster processing for ICT staff and start-up founders could ease mobility between the two Baltic neighbours.
